Changed RequireHttpsAttribute to default to 302 instead of 301
This commit is contained in:
parent
3aa42617a4
commit
f4679fe74f
|
|
@ -84,7 +84,7 @@ namespace Microsoft.AspNetCore.Mvc
|
||||||
request.QueryString.ToUriComponent());
|
request.QueryString.ToUriComponent());
|
||||||
|
|
||||||
// redirect to HTTPS version of page
|
// redirect to HTTPS version of page
|
||||||
filterContext.Result = new RedirectResult(newUrl, permanent: true);
|
filterContext.Result = new RedirectResult(newUrl, permanent: false);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
|
||||||
|
|
@ -99,7 +99,7 @@ namespace Microsoft.AspNetCore.Mvc
|
||||||
Assert.NotNull(authContext.Result);
|
Assert.NotNull(authContext.Result);
|
||||||
var result = Assert.IsType<RedirectResult>(authContext.Result);
|
var result = Assert.IsType<RedirectResult>(authContext.Result);
|
||||||
|
|
||||||
Assert.True(result.Permanent);
|
Assert.False(result.Permanent);
|
||||||
Assert.Equal(expectedUrl, result.Url);
|
Assert.Equal(expectedUrl, result.Url);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
@ -216,4 +216,4 @@ namespace Microsoft.AspNetCore.Mvc
|
||||||
return services.BuildServiceProvider();
|
return services.BuildServiceProvider();
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
|
||||||
|
|
@ -178,7 +178,7 @@ namespace Microsoft.AspNetCore.Mvc.FunctionalTests
|
||||||
var response = await Client.GetAsync("Home/HttpsOnlyAction");
|
var response = await Client.GetAsync("Home/HttpsOnlyAction");
|
||||||
|
|
||||||
// Assert
|
// Assert
|
||||||
Assert.Equal(HttpStatusCode.MovedPermanently, response.StatusCode);
|
Assert.Equal(HttpStatusCode.Found, response.StatusCode);
|
||||||
Assert.NotNull(response.Headers.Location);
|
Assert.NotNull(response.Headers.Location);
|
||||||
Assert.Equal("https://localhost/Home/HttpsOnlyAction", response.Headers.Location.ToString());
|
Assert.Equal("https://localhost/Home/HttpsOnlyAction", response.Headers.Location.ToString());
|
||||||
Assert.Equal(0, response.Content.Headers.ContentLength);
|
Assert.Equal(0, response.Content.Headers.ContentLength);
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ue